Taylor Schilling, an American actress, is the name behind the character Piper Chapman in the groundbreaking Netflix series Orange is the New Black, and her career is a testament to both her talent and her dedication to her craft.
Born on July 27, 1984, in Boston, Massachusetts, Taylor Schilling's journey to stardom is a fascinating story of perseverance and artistic expression. Her breakthrough role as Piper Chapman, a young woman sentenced to prison, not only brought her critical acclaim but also helped to shape the cultural landscape of television. The show, known for its bold storytelling and diverse cast, was a critical and commercial success, running for seven seasons and earning numerous awards. For much of the 2010s, Schilling led the cast of one of the most impactful shows on television, a show that explored themes of identity, sexuality, and social justice with unparalleled honesty.
Beyond Orange is the New Black, Schilling has showcased her versatility in a range of film projects. She has demonstrated her ability to embody diverse characters, solidifying her position as a respected figure in the entertainment industry. Her performances in films like The Lucky One, Argo, The Overnight, and The Titan have highlighted her range and further endeared her to audiences. She won a Satellite Award for her performance in Orange is the New Black in 2013, a testament to her skill and the show's cultural impact. The actress has received nominations for prestigious awards like the Golden Globe Award, for Best Actress in a Television Series - Drama in 2013, and the Golden Globe Award for Best Actress Television Series Musical or Comedy in 2014.

Schilling's portrayal of Piper Chapman in Orange is the New Black was, undoubtedly, a defining role in her career. The Netflix series, which premiered in 2013, quickly became a cultural phenomenon. The show offered a fresh perspective on the lives of women in prison, tackling complex social issues with humor and humanity. Schilling's performance was pivotal to the show's success, earning her both critical praise and a dedicated fanbase. The series was groundbreaking in its representation of LGBTQ+ characters and storylines, with Schillings character at the heart of some of the most compelling narratives. The series also served as a platform for a diverse cast of actresses and provided opportunities for many new talents.
The final season premiere of Orange is the New Black at Alice Tully Hall at Lincoln Center, New York, NY on July 25, 2019, marked the end of an era. Taylor Schilling, along with the rest of the cast, was present, bringing a sense of closure to the fans of the show. This event underscored the impact of the series and the significant role that Schilling played in its success. In 2018, she starred in the film Family, a comedy about an emotionally stunted aunt who attempts to form a relationship with her teenage niece.
